The Good

  • Generous Bonuses: Many loyalty programs offer substantial bonuses. For instance, a typical program may provide a 10% cashback on losses, effectively increasing the player’s return.
  • Tiered Rewards: Players can earn points based on their gameplay, often leading to tiered rewards. This system encourages continued play, as higher tiers unlock exclusive benefits.
  • Free Spins and Bonuses: Regular promotions can include free spins or bonus credits, which can be a significant draw for players.

The Bad

  • Wagering Requirements: Many loyalty bonuses come with high wagering requirements, often around 35x. This means players must wager a significant amount before they can withdraw their winnings.
  • Limited Eligibility: Some loyalty programs may restrict certain games, meaning not all gameplay contributes to earning rewards. For example, slots may contribute 100%, while table games might only contribute 10%.
  • Expiration of Points: Loyalty points may expire after a certain period, which can discourage players from cashing in on their rewards in a timely manner.

The Ugly

  • Hidden Terms: Many programs have convoluted terms that players may overlook. Hidden conditions can significantly reduce the perceived value of loyalty rewards.
  • Low Conversion Rates: Some loyalty points convert to cash at a very low rate, making it difficult for players to realize actual monetary benefits. For example, 100 loyalty points may only equate to £1.
  • Poor Customer Support: Issues with loyalty rewards can arise, and poor customer service may leave players frustrated when trying to resolve these issues.
